1. Complete Process of the 2026 Georgia IVF Cycle
A standard Georgia IVF cycle typically takes 25 to 30 days and is divided into the following stages:
- Initial Consultation and Physical Examination: The couple completes basic health checks in their home country, including hormone panel, semen analysis, AMH, and infectious disease screening. Reports are sent to the reproductive center in Georgia for remote evaluation.
- Travel to Georgia and Ovarian Stimulation: Arrive in Georgia on day 2 or 3 of the menstrual cycle to begin ovarian stimulation, which lasts about 10 to 12 days. Follicle development is monitored every 2 to 3 days.
- Egg Retrieval and Sperm Collection: Eggs are retrieved via transvaginal ultrasound-guided aspiration under anesthesia, taking about 15 to 20 minutes. The male partner provides a sperm sample simultaneously.
- Fertilization and Embryo Culture: Fertilization is performed using second or third-generation IVF techniques. Embryos are cultured in the laboratory for 5 to 6 days to reach the blastocyst stage.
- Embryo Screening and Freezing: If third-generation IVF is chosen, blastocysts undergo chromosomal screening. Healthy embryos after screening are cryopreserved for future transfer.
- Embryo Transfer: In the next cycle or after a prepared cycle, thawed embryos are transferred into the uterus. A pregnancy test is conducted 12 to 14 days after the transfer.
The entire cycle requires a stay in Georgia of approximately 20 to 25 days. Some stages, such as ovarian stimulation and transfer, can be completed in two separate visits to reduce the length of a single stay.
2. Detailed Costs of the 2026 Georgia IVF Cycle
In 2026, the cost of a Georgia IVF cycle remains highly cost-effective, with total expenses ranging from approximately 80,000 to 120,000 RMB. The specific breakdown is as follows:
| Item | Cost Range (RMB) |
|---|---|
| Medical fees (including stimulation, egg retrieval, embryo culture, transfer) | 50,000 - 80,000 RMB |
| Third-generation IVF genetic screening | 10,000 - 20,000 RMB |
| Living expenses (accommodation, meals, transportation, based on 25 days) | 15,000 - 25,000 RMB |
| Translation and agency service fees | 5,000 - 15,000 RMB |
| Frozen embryo storage fee (annual) | 3,000 - 5,000 RMB |
It is important to note that specific costs may vary depending on individual health conditions, medication protocols, and the chosen hospital. It is recommended to confirm a detailed fee schedule with the hospital or service provider before starting the cycle.

Is it convenient to travel from China to Georgia for IVF in 2026?
Very convenient. Georgia has a visa-free policy for Chinese citizens. Chinese passport holders can enter visa-free and stay for up to 30 days, which fully covers the time needed for an IVF cycle. There are direct flights from Beijing, Shanghai, Urumqi, and other cities to Tbilisi.
